There is no quarterly STOCK BONUS. Executives are awarded restricted stock and receive dividends quarterly. RSU/EBU are awarded ANNUALLY in Nov/Dec. 2020 awards will be interesting to watch. Earnings Bonus units (cash bonus) are "underwater" since earnings are terrible. SO no Cash Bonus. Senior Executives will probably see 20 to 30% drop in 2020 compensation vs 2019. XOM also force ranks its executives and the bottom 20% get no cash or stock bonus. And fourth quintile only gets about a third of the max award. Even top quintile executives will see a reduction in RSU awarded. This reduction occurs every time XOM underperforms. It happened in 2017
